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
952921 16654 01 94276 1035521914
377323815 8480710
377323815 8480710
830235800 57996076 9272753
All about undefined
Interested in learning more?
377323815 8480710
830235800 57996076 9272753
See more
55140 85257532
75643061 9726584629 59
See more
022209 95
929785 59 0905
See more